Re: Carbon comp resistors
I have a huge stash of vintage Allen Bradley carbon comps, and I use them for nearly 100% of my amp circuits. The one spot I prefer carbon film is in the reverb mix circuit because the CC can get a bit noisy there. Any noise they add can be engineered out by balancing the gain structure of the amp i...

Re: "Line level" output help
The output impedance of a triode is somewhere in the 20-30k range depending on what you use. That means you should be fine with just a t-pad on the output to knock the signal down. I'd put the pad or a pot after the coupling cap and call it done If you want to get fancy you can add a diode clamp cir...
